Functions
The Council performs the following duties:
- Educational Planning: Schedule of teaching and training activities, including rotations within the training network and the specific activities required for admission to the annual proficiency exam.
- Leadership: Elects the Head of the Residency Program.
- Tutorship: Appoints Tutors responsible for guidance, qualitative learning assessment, and certification of the resident's acquired skills. It may also appoint tutors to monitor practical activities and designate a coordinator to act as a liaison for these activities.
- Teaching Assignments: Proposes teaching assignments for the different disciplines
- Didactic Commission: May establish a specific Didactic Commission to define training paths, rotation requirements, and indicators for evaluating educational quality and continuity.
- Monitoring: Establishes methods for recording and certifying resident activities, particularly practical activities, as per current regulations.
- External Agreements: Deliberates on proposed agreements with external facilities to establish or update the training network or for internships/traineeships outside the network.
